Drance was a Los Angeles-based queer industrial dance band that emerged from within Silver Lake’s Club Fuck! scene between 1989-1992. Burning brightly in L.A during the AIDS crisis, their songs reflected an uneasiness toward disease and modern culture, a lust for the forbidden, and a raw desire and rage to stay alive on their own terms.

“Latex Love” has been remastered for its first-ever release on vinyl. The track has been updated with a brilliant cover by Kris Baha, as well as a cracking remix from Spotlight’s Chris Cruse. The vinyl package includes an essay from artist (and Club Fuck! go-go dancer) Ron Athey, unpublished photos of the band by Michael Matson, and a reproduction of the original Drance sticker.
